Nvidia has announced its ambitious plan to dispatch Graphics Processing Units (GPUs) to the moon. This initiative isn’t just about hardware; it signifies a leap forward in how we approach space exploration, particularly with the increasing reliance on artificial intelligence (AI). By integrating cutting-edge GPU technology, Nvidia aims to empower lunar missions with superior data processing capabilities, enabling real-time analysis and boosting the effectiveness of scientific endeavors.
Launching in early 2024, these GPUs will facilitate critical tasks on the lunar surface, including high-resolution imaging and data analysis through AI algorithms. This is particularly crucial as missions become more complex and aim to gather unprecedented amounts of data about the moon's geology and potential resources.
The importance of this initiative resonates beyond just technological innovation; it has far-reaching implications for the global space sector. By sending GPUs to the moon, Nvidia not only reinforces its position as a leader in AI and GPU technology but also opens avenues for collaborations with space agencies and private enterprises alike.
